Help Treat the Fear of Sound With Sileo

Sileo is the first FDA-approved treatment for dogs that suffer from a serious condition called noise aversion. Prescribed by your Veterinarian, Sileo helps calm your dog when frightened by loud noises without making them drowsy. Sileo is ideal for events like fireworks, thunder, or construction noise, and everyday noises like vacuums and lawn equipment. It is designed to be used at home—where you and your dog need it most.

Easy to Administer and Works Quickly 

Sileo is given orally in an easy-to-administer gel and goes to work fast. It begins to take effect in as little as 30 minutes and can last for 2–3 hours, offering a timely and reliable way to ease your dog’s response to noise. There is no need for daily medication. It is clinically demonstrated to work without other treatments or training.[1]

I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S

Do not use Sileo in dogs with severe cardiovascular disease, respiratory, liver or kidney diseases, or in conditions of shock, sever debilitations, or stress due to extreme heat, cold, fatigue or in dogs hypersensitive to dexmedetomidine pr to any of the excipients. Sileo should not be administered in the presence of preexisting hypotension, hypoxia, or bradycardia. Do not use in dogs sedated from previous dosing. Sileo has not been evaluated in dogs younger than 16 weeks of age or in dogs with dental or gingival disease that could have an effect on the absorption of Sileo. Sileo has not been evaluated for use in breeding, pregnant, or lactating dogs or for aversion behaviors to thunderstorms. Transient pale mucous membranes at the site of application may occur with Sileo use. Other uncommon adverse reactions included emesis, drowsiness or sedation. Handlers should avoid direct exposure of Sileo to their skin, eyes, or mouth. Always review IN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E before dispensing and dosing. See gull Prescribing Information at SileoPI.com

I really wanted this to work for my adult dog's sudden onset storm anxiety/noise aversion. Unfortunately, it barely took the edge off. I may have kept at it to see

I really wanted this to work for my adult dog's sudden onset storm anxiety/noise aversion. Unfortunately, it barely took the edge off. I may have kept at it to see if result improved if it wasn't a pain to administer. It must taste really really bad. Applying it to the mouth wasn't difficult the first time but boy did my dog remember just how bad it tasted and subsequent doses were difficult. We had previously tried trials of several different CBD products, Composure Pro, other herbal supplements (passionflower/valerian/chamomile, etc.) , and Trazodone. Trazodone specifically, caused anxiety and agitation for 2 hours prior to him being really dopey and hungover for 12+ hours, although I know this reaction is atypical. My boy has paradoxical reactions to several medications. I was pleased the Sileo did not make him groggy or heavily sedated. It just didn't do quite enough for him. The dosing for 70 pounds was getting quite expensive during storm and fireworks season. He has since had good result with Alprazolam.
